在Linux环境下配置计算机视觉数据库,首先需要选择合适的数据库系统。常见的选项包括PostgreSQL、MySQL和MongoDB,每种数据库都有其适用场景。PostgreSQL适合处理结构化数据,而MongoDB则更适合非结构化或半结构化数据。
安装数据库后,需进行基础配置以确保其性能。例如,调整内存分配、设置适当的连接数限制以及优化日志记录方式。这些配置可以显著提升数据库的响应速度和稳定性。

AI生成内容,仅供参考
对于计算机视觉应用,图像和视频数据通常较大,因此建议使用文件存储与数据库结合的方式。将元数据存储在数据库中,而实际媒体文件保存在文件系统或对象存储中,可以提高整体效率。
性能优化方面,索引的合理使用至关重要。为常用查询字段添加索引,可以加快数据检索速度。同时,定期清理无用数据并维护数据库,有助于保持系统的高效运行。
使用缓存机制如Redis或Memcached,可以减少对数据库的直接访问,从而降低负载并提高响应速度。•监控数据库性能指标,如CPU使用率、内存占用和查询延迟,有助于及时发现并解决问题。
•定期备份数据库是保障数据安全的重要措施。通过脚本自动化备份,并将备份存储在远程位置,可以有效防止数据丢失。